Long Rail Gully Cabernet Sauvignon 2021

A$28.95
Sold Out

The 2018 Cabernet Sauvignon reflects the long slow ripening of the grapes. The cool season produced ripe fruit with soft tannins bursting with varietal character.

A selected quality parcel of grapes was cold soaked and fermented in open top stainless steel fermenters and then left on skins for a total of 5 weeks to soften structure and add body to the finished wine.

The wine was then barrel aged for 12 months in a mixture of quality 100% French oak barrels.

The wine has a highly lifted nose of blackberry and blackcurrant. The 2017 is a rich Cabernet with fine tannins and a soft mouth filling palate.

Drink now or be rewarded with careful cellaring.
